Q.
The sum of the squares of deviations for $10$ observations taken from their mean $50$ is $250$. The coefficient of variation is
Solution:
Let, $x i, i=1,2 \ldots 10$ be 10 observations
We have $\displaystyle\sum_{i=1}^{10}(x i-50)^{2}=250$
Now $\sigma^{2}=\frac{1}{10} \displaystyle\sum_{i=1}^{10}(x i-50)^{2}$
$=\frac{250}{10}=25\,\,\,\sigma=5$
$\therefore C . V=\frac{\sigma}{x} \times 100$
$=\frac{5}{50} \times 100=10 \%$
